Sourcing guidance for Zinc Plating Machine

What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a zinc plating machine?

Buyers should prioritize the automation level (fully automatic, semi-automatic, or manual) based on production volume. Key components include the rectifier capacity (ensure stable current output), tank material (PP or PVC plates with at least 15-20mm thickness for chemical resistance), and the heating/cooling system to maintain electrolyte stability. For barrel plating, check the perforation size to ensure it matches your smallest workpieces.

Which compliance standards and certifications are mandatory for international trade?

Ensure the equipment carries the CE Marking for European markets or meets UL standards for North America. Since these machines involve chemicals, the supplier must provide a Certificate of Compliance for Environmental Protection and ensure the design facilitates wastewater treatment integration to meet local environmental regulations like ISO 14001.

How do I evaluate the production efficiency and energy consumption of the machine?

Request data on the cycle time per rack or barrel and the maximum load capacity. Look for machines equipped with energy-saving high-frequency switching rectifiers, which can reduce power consumption by 15-20% compared to traditional silicon-controlled rectifiers. Additionally, verify if the PLC control system (e.g., Siemens or Mitsubishi) supports remote monitoring for optimized uptime.

What maintenance protocols are required to ensure a long service life?

A professional setup requires daily inspection of electrode contacts and weekly cleaning of the filtration system. Ensure the supplier provides a detailed maintenance manual and a one-year warranty covering critical parts like pumps and motors. The use of corrosion-resistant coatings on the outer frame is essential to prevent acid-mist damage.

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ategies

How can I mitigate the risks of purchasing heavy industrial machinery from overseas?

It is highly recommended to h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or Intertek) to conduct a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) to verify the machine's functionality and component authenticity before the final balance is paid.

What are the best practices for negotiating with zinc plating machine suppliers?

Focus on the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the sticker price. Negotiate for the inclusion of vulnerable spare parts (e.g., filter bags, heaters, sensors) for the first two years of operation. Ask for FAT (Factory Acceptance Test) video proof or a live stream demonstration of the machine running with a load before crating.

What logistics and installation precautions should be taken for large-scale equipment?

Due to the size and weight, use Professional Sea Freight (FCL) and ensure the machine is packed in vacuum-sealed plastic within fumigated wooden crates to prevent sea-salt corrosion. Confirm whether the supplier offers overseas installation guidance via video call or if they can dispatch engineers to your site, and clarify who bears the cost of travel and accommodation.

How do I ensure the machine aligns with my country's electricity and safety codes?

Before manufacturing, explicitly confirm the local voltage and frequency (e.g., 380V/50Hz vs 480V/60Hz). Ensure all wiring follows international color codes and that emergency stop buttons and safety light curtains are installed according to your local occupational safety laws.
